本文说明如何在平台中完成维度的创建与配置,适用于预算、合并、管报等场景。
拥有系统管理员账号,或已被授权维度组件操作权限的管理员账号。
目标空间已完成维度组件注册。
登录平台后,进入目标应用,在 元素管理 中点击 + 新建 > 维度,进入维度类型选择界面。
维度类型决定了该维度在系统中的业务角色和计算规则,创建后不可修改,请根据业务用途提前确认好类型再创建。
|
维度类型 |
典型用途 |
|---|---|
|
通用类 |
最通用的一类,适合产品、渠道、项目、客户等业务分类。查询时父级数据由子级按比重自动汇总。 |
|
科目类 |
承载财务科目和业务指标,是取数和汇总的核心口径。 |
|
年份类 |
定义财年,需要与期间类配合使用,共同构成会计时间轴。 |
|
期间类 |
定义会计期间(年/季/月等层级),通常与年份类配合使用,并联动生成视图维。 |
|
场景类 |
区分预算、实际、预测等数据场景,成员可配置生效年份和期间范围。 |
|
版本类 |
区分同一场景下的多个版本(如预算 V1、V2)。 |
|
实体类 |
承载组织主体结构,例如集团-区域-法人-部门的层级。 |
|
多版本实体类 |
在实体类基础上支持组织架构随时间或场景变化,适用于组织口径需要按年/期间/场景动态切换的项目。 |
|
变动类 |
用于合并场景,记录期初、增加、减少、时点数等变动口径,驱动期末余额自动推算。 |
|
值类 |
合并场景专用,表示值口径(本位币数、上级币种数、抵销数等)。不单独创建,由实体类关联本位币后自动生成。 |
|
视图类 |
控制期间数据的展示和聚合方式(YTD、Periodic、QTD 等)。不单独创建,由期间类配置期间层级后自动生成。 |
选择维度类型后,点击左上角 设置 图标,在右侧属性面板完成配置。

|
属性名称 |
设置方式 |
必填 |
说明 |
|---|---|---|---|
|
编码(name) |
输入框,只允许字母、数字、下划线,长度 50 |
是 |
不可重复,保存后不可修改,建议提前制定命名规范。 |
|
名称(简体) |
输入框,长度 255 |
否 |
维度的中文展示名称。 |
|
名称(英文) |
输入框,长度 255 |
否 |
维度的英文展示名称。 |
|
类型 |
自动带出 |
是 |
创建时确定,保存后不可修改。 |
|
维度基数类型 |
低基/普通/高基,保存后不可修改 |
是 |
表示维度成员的预计规模,默认为普通维度。成员数量小于 1,000 时选择低基,1,000~50,000 时选择普通,大于 50,000 时选择高基。保存后不可修改,请在创建前根据业务预期合理评估。 |
|
启用层级管理 |
开关 |
否 |
开启后可维护层级结构,使用时成员可按层级展示和筛选。 |
|
默认权限方案 |
元素选择框 |
否 |
关联权限方案后,该维度的成员查询结果会按当前角色自动过滤。 |
|
引用关系管理 |
只读 |
— |
查看该维度当前被哪些元素引用,便于在修改前评估影响范围。 |
关于维度基数类型的选择
低基和普通维度在底层使用 ClickHouse 字典表,字典表将全量成员数据加载进内存,查询速度极快,但受服务器内存上限制约。成员数量越多,字典表占用的内存越大;当成员量超出内存承载范围时,字典表可能出现加载失败或服务不稳定的问题。
高基维度底层使用 ClickHouse 普通表,数据存储在磁盘而非内存,因此可以稳定支撑超大规模的成员数量。代价是每次查询需要进行磁盘 I/O,查询性能低于字典表。
因此,高基维度不是”性能更好”的选项,而是成员超过 5 万后保障服务稳定性的必要方案。系统建议尽量将成员数量控制在 50,000 以内,在字典表的内存限制内运行,以获得最佳查询性能。确实需要超过 5 万成员的维度,请在创建时就选择高基,避免后期因无法修改而被迫删除重建。
部分维度类型有额外的专属配置项:
实体维可以在属性栏中关联一个通用类维度作为 本位币,关联后有两个效果:
实体成员会新增本位币属性,可为每个实体分别指定所用币种。
系统会在该实体维的同路径下自动创建一个 Value 值维,供合并报表使用。

基础配置与实体类一致。额外需要配置 版本管理模块:可以在年、期间、场景、版本四类维度中任意选 0~4 种作为版本管理的维度。配置后,该维度能够按所选维度成员的每个组合,返回对应时期的组织架构。
建议仅在组织架构确实存在多套口径时启用多版本实体,避免过早引入不必要的配置复杂度。

场景维可以在属性栏中关联年份类和期间类维度。关联后,场景成员可以配置 开始/结束年份 和 开始/结束期间,用于约束该场景的数据读写有效区间——例如在滚动预测中,不同轮次的场景可以有各自的时间范围,避免误写历史数据。

成员维护支持 树形视图 和 表格视图 两种方式,两种视图均在点击 保存 后统一生效。
树形视图适合日常的结构化维护,可以直观地看到层级关系。
在 维度成员 区域点击 添加。
对于新建的维度,初始状态只能在根节点 #root 下添加 子级成员。
选中某一成员后,可以选择添加 同级成员 或 子级成员;未选中任何成员时只允许添加子级成员。
成员编码在同一维度内不可重复。

表格视图适合批量维护,支持多行同时操作,并可按列条件筛选定位目标成员。
增量模式:只处理新增数据,遇到重名成员则覆盖,已有成员行灰底不可编辑。适合日常追加成员或局部修订。
全量模式:先全部删除再重建,适合成员结构的整体调整。如果有共享成员的维护需求,只能通过全量策略提交。
单元格校验失败时会标红提示,保存前需要逐一处理。

不同维度类型的成员会显示不同的属性,以下是完整清单:
|
属性名称 |
说明 |
|---|---|
|
编码 |
成员唯一标识,新增后不可修改。 |
|
父级编码 |
自动根据树形结构生成,不可手动编辑。 |
|
名称(中文/英文) |
按空间语言展示,支持多语言维护。 |
|
比重 |
用于汇总计算,期间类成员不具有该属性。 |
|
共享节点 |
控制该成员是否在多个父节点下共享。树形视图不可编辑,需在表格视图中操作。 |
|
层级 |
仅期间类成员具有,按期间层级配置自动生成,不可手动修改。 |
|
本位币 |
仅实体类成员具有,从关联的本位币维度中选择。 |
|
开始/结束年份 |
仅场景类成员具有,控制场景生效的年份范围。 |
|
开始/结束期间 |
仅场景类成员具有,若选择了期间则年份必须同步指定。 |
|
实际年份 |
仅年份类成员具有。 |
|
自上而下 |
仅版本类成员具有。不勾选时,通用维度的父级成员数据由子级按比重自动汇总;勾选后,父级可以直接录入数据,读取时不再从子级汇总。 |
|
数据类型 |
仅科目类成员具有,支持数字、文本、比率、日期、维度。 |
|
科目类型 |
仅科目类成员具有,取值范围:资产、标签、权益、费用、收入、负债、期间数、时点数、无科目类型。其中资产和费用为借方科目,负债、权益、收入为贷方科目。科目类型决定了该科目在模型中的汇总逻辑;标签类成员不存储数据,仅作标记用途。 |
|
允许在父级节点输入 |
仅科目类成员具有。开启后,该科目可以在通用维度父级节点直接录入数值,读取时直接从父级取数,不再按子级汇总。 |
树形视图中,可以删除单个成员,或删除成员及其全部后代。
表格视图中,可以通过删除行进行批量删除。

期间类的成员不需要手动逐条创建。创建期间维后,点击 编辑期间层级,在弹出框中选择要启用的层级(如年/季/月),确认后系统会自动生成对应的期间成员,并同步创建与之绑定的视图维及其成员。

变动维的成员需要为每个末级节点指定 变动类型,四种类型分别是:
|
变动类型 |
含义 |
|---|---|
|
OPN |
Opening,期初余额 |
|
INC |
Increase,本期增加 |
|
DEC |
Decrease,本期减少 |
|
BAL |
Balance,时点数 |
每种类型在财务模型自动计算累计数时有不同的计算规则。当类型为 OPN 时,可以为其指定 对应期末余额 成员(本维度的其他成员),其他类型不可配置该属性。父级节点无需设置变动类型,其数据逻辑为子级汇总(通常显示为 Closing)。

如需为成员添加分类标签或扩展字段,请参考 配置自定义属性。
维度的成员规模受以下三个维度共同影响,在项目规划阶段应综合评估:
|
限制项 |
上限 |
说明 |
|---|---|---|
|
成员数量 |
建议不超过 50,000 |
超过 50,000 时须选高基维度,查询性能低于普通维度 |
|
层级深度 |
最多 20 层 |
层级越深,每个成员需存储的路径数据越多,整体数据量越大 |
|
自定义属性(UD)列数 |
最多 60 列 |
列数越多,每个成员的存储宽度越大 |
三者叠加会显著增加每次保存的数据量。当成员数量多、层级深、UD 列数多同时出现时,保存速度会明显下降,极端情况下可能出现保存超时失败。建议按实际业务需要配置,避免不必要的宽表或深层级设计。
完成上述配置后,点击 保存 按钮。首次保存时会弹出元素属性窗口,填写以下信息:

|
属性名称 |
设置方式 |
必填 |
说明 |
|---|---|---|---|
|
编码 |
输入框(字母、数字、下划线,长度 50) |
是 |
在所在目录内不可重复。 |
|
名称(英语) |
输入框,长度 255 |
否 |
英文展示名称。 |
|
名称(简体) |
输入框,长度 255 |
否 |
中文展示名称。 |
|
位置 |
下拉选择框 |
是 |
默认为当前目录,可调整至其他目录。 |
成员提交失败,提示”找不到父节点”:通常是数据中子成员排在父成员之前导致的。可以在数据流提交时启用”成员重排序”功能,系统会自动按先父后子的顺序重新排列数据。注意数据量较大时该操作会影响性能,建议按需开启。
表格视图编辑后无法保存:先找到标红的单元格,逐一处理校验错误后再保存。
合并场景中找不到 Value 值维:检查对应实体维是否已关联本位币,关联后系统才会自动创建 Value 维。
回到顶部
咨询热线
